Illuminating the Serendipity of Albert Hofmann's LSD Discovery
In 1943, amidst a seemingly mundane research, Swiss chemist Albert Hofmann embarked on a journey that would profoundly alter the course of history. While investigating the potential properties of a recently synthesized compound, LSD, Hofmann unexpectedly ingested a minuscule dose. What followed was an unprecedented spiritual experience, characterized by vivid perceptions and profound shifts in his perception of reality. This accidental revelation with LSD opened the door to a uncharted realm of altered states of consciousness, forever redefining our understanding of the brain.
Over decades that followed, Hofmann's initial fortuitous finding ignited a wave of scientific inquiry and cultural fascination with LSD. From its early use in therapeutic settings to its later association with the counterculture movement, LSD has remained a potent symbol of both the promise and the nuance of human consciousness.

The Science Behind LSD: Delving into Its Psychoactive Effects
LSD, or lysergic acid diethylamide, is a potent hallucinogenic drug known for its ability to induce profound alterations in perception, thought, and emotion. The mechanism of action of LSD involves its attachment with serotonin receptors in the brain, particularly the 5-HT2A website receptor subtype. This modulation of serotonin signaling is believed to be responsible for the characteristic hallucinatory experiences associated with LSD use.
Research suggests that LSD can affect a wide range of cognitive processes, including attention, memory, and decision-making. It can also trigger emotional responses, ranging from euphoria and elation to anxiety and fear. The length of LSD's effects typically lasts for several hours, after which users gradually return to their baseline state.
- The intensity of LSD's effects can vary depending on a number of factors, including the dose taken, individual sensitivity, and the setting in which it is consumed.
